CIGARS

Result Pages: [<< Prev]  ... 11  12  13  14  15 ...  [Next >>]  Displaying 241 to 264 (of 434 products) View all
Sort by:  
[<< Prev]  ... 11  12  13  14  15 ...  [Next >>] 
Trustpilot